This is the Iju railway station, Agege, Lagos.

It is the terminating and originating terminal for commuters going to Agege, Agbado, Kajola, Papalanto, Yaba, Ikeja-Along, Ebute-Metta, etc.

The Iju train station building is an old structure built over 60 years ago during the British rule in Nigeria.

This train station is part of the network of railway lines in the ongoing project to connect the bustling coastal city of Lagos to Nigeria's third-largest city, Ibadan, in the second stage of the government's railway modernisation project.

The modernisation project under the supervision of the Nigeria Railway Corporation (NRC) will see to the construction of 144km (90 miles) of railway tracks.
